Former Republican Congressman Vin Weber of Minnesota says he hopes President Obama will succeed, but he is concerned about some of Obama's policies and political strategies. Weber spoke last week at the University of Minnesota's Humphrey Institute of Public Affairs.

Vin Weber served six terms in the U.S. House, representing Minnesota from 1981 to 1993, and he is now managing partner for the Washington, D.C. consulting firm Clark and Weinstock.
